Как устроены базы данных и зачем они требуются
Базы данных представляют собой структурированные репозитории информации, которые эксплуатируются практически во всех нынешних электронных структурах. Каждый день множества людей соприкасаются с базами данных, даже не подозревая об этом. Когда пользователь запускает социальную сеть, производит транзакцию в интернет-магазине или контролирует состояние карты, за кулисами работают комплексные механизмы контроля сведениями.
Ключевая миссия базы данных выражается в упорядочении и сохранении значительных количеств данных. Данные находятся в специальных структурах, которые дают возможность моментально отыскивать требуемые данные. up x предоставляет не только сохранение, но и оптимальную обработку сведений.
Актуальные базы данных построены по способу схем, где данные организуется по строкам и колонкам. Выделенные утилиты управляют доступом к данным и контролируют за сохранностью информации. ап икс официальный сайт обеспечивает составлять комплексные команды для извлечения нужной информации за доли секунды.
Что такое база данных и её ключевое предназначение
База данных — это организованная коллекция сведений, созданная для эффективного содержания, нахождения и обработки. Такие структуры включают структурированные данные о покупателях, товарах, транзакциях и других единицах. Информация размещается в организованном виде, что помогает стремительно иметь подключение к необходимым элементам.
Главное предназначение базы данных состоит в централизованном администрировании данными. Вместо хранения информации в отдельных файлах учреждения используют единое накопитель. ап икс облегчает работу с сведениями и предотвращает копирование строк.
Базы данных реализуют задачу коллективного обращения к данным. Несколько сотрудников могут параллельно работать с аналогичными и теми же информацией без столкновений. up x подтверждает непротиворечивость информации даже при повышенной загрузке.
Нынешние базы данных осуществляют устойчивость хранения критически существенной данных. Инструменты запасного копирования охраняют информацию от утраты при сбоях оборудования.
Организация данных в структурированном формате
Упорядочение информации представляет собой главный подход работы баз данных. Информация размещаются по таблицам, где каждая запись вмещает отдельную строку, а колонки устанавливают свойства объектов. Такая система позволяет логически группировать однородную информацию.
Каждая матрица в базе данных содержит строгую конструкцию с определёнными параметрами. Поле составляет собой отдельный атрибут элемента, например имя покупателя или стоимость товара. Обеспечивает унификацию содержания сведений и ускоряет её управление.
Систематизированная схема данных содержит несколько важных составляющих:
- Главные идентификаторы для неповторимой идентификации строк
- Виды сведений для управления структуры информации
- Индексы для ускорения обнаружения по схемам
- Правила целостности для устранения погрешностей
Правильная схема базы данных исключает повторение информации. Уменьшает размер сохранённых сведений и ускоряет актуализацию. Нормализация схем исключает копирование.
Содержание больших объёмов информации и стремительный обращение к ним
Современные базы данных в состоянии хранить терабайты и петабайты сведений. Значительные организации накапливают миллиарды записей о пользователях и транзакциях. up x совершенствует эксплуатацию жёсткого ресурса и рабочей памяти.
Оперативность подключения к данным является критически важным параметром работы баз данных. Участники рассчитывают на мгновенных реакций на команды даже при выполнении миллионов элементов. Индексирование матриц даёт возможность выявлять требуемые сведения за части секунды.
Кэширование часто извлекаемых сведений повышает работу программ. База данных сохраняет распространённые обращения в рабочей ресурсе для мгновенного подключения. Сокращает нагрузку на накопительную часть и повышает эффективность структуры.
Разнесённые базы данных хранят данные на нескольких узлах. Такая структура осуществляет горизонтальное увеличение и управление расширяющихся объёмов сведений.
Соединения между информацией и структура их структурирования
Отношения между схемами создают основу структурированных баз данных. Разнообразные типы данных соединяются через выделенные главные параметры, создавая непротиворечивую систему. ап икс гарантирует логическую сохранность и непротиворечивость всей системы.
Вторичные идентификаторы устанавливают соединения между таблицами. Поле в одной таблице ссылается на основной код другой матрицы, образуя взаимосвязь между данными. Такая организация помогает сохранять данные о заказчиках независимо от сведений о покупках.
Базы данных поддерживают несколько категорий отношений между матрицами:
- Один к одному — каждая строка связана с единственной записью
- Один ко многим — одна запись соединена с различными элементами
- Многие ко многим — множественные строки связаны между собой
Стандартизация данных устраняет дублирование и оптимизирует архитектуру базы. Сегментирует информацию на последовательные кластеры и формирует правильные отношения. Метод нормализации улучшает продуктивность содержания данных.
Эксплуатация баз данных в обычных службах
Базы данных трудятся в фоновом формате практически каждого электронного службы. Социальные сети размещают профили участников, изображения и записи в огромных базах данных. Каждое действие — публикация материала или комментарий — сохраняется в платформу и делается видимым для иных членов.
Интернет-магазины используют базы данных для контроля каталогами продуктов и переработки покупок. ап икс официальный сайт позволяет моментально обновлять сведения о присутствии изделий и отображать современные расценки. Механизмы подсказок изучают хронологию транзакций и предлагают позиции на базе интересов.
Финансовые приложения осуществляют миллионы платежей каждодневно. База данных сохраняет каждый транзит и операцию с скрупулёзностью до копейки. Подтверждает целостность экономической данных и блокирует неразрешённый подключение.
Геолокационные сервисы размещают планы и информацию о пробках в особых базах. Системы резервирования управляют свободностью мест и обрабатывают резервирования в формате текущего времени.
Безопасность и обеспечение информации в базах данных
Обеспечение данных составляет собой первостепенную задачу всякой комплекса управления базами. Конфиденциальная сведения клиентов и экономические строки предполагают стабильной обеспечения от неразрешённого проникновения. Многоуровневая структура защиты регулирует каждое запрос к сведениям.
Верификация клиентов подтверждает идентичность каждого, кто подключается к базе данных. Механизмы запрашивают указания учётной записи и пароля, а также могут использовать двухфакторную идентификацию. up x разделяет полномочия обращения для разнообразных классов клиентов.
Шифрование данных оберегает сведения при содержании и отправке по линии. База данных переводит открытый текст в закодированный шифр, который невозможно расшифровать без специального ключа. Обеспечивает секретность даже при физическом обращении к серверам.
Регистрация операций регистрирует все активности участников в базе данных. Комплекс сохраняет дату запроса и завершённые запросы. Аудит позволяет отследить странную активность.
Актуализация и координация информации в текущем времени
Современные базы данных обрабатывают модификации данных немедленно. Когда пользователь актуализирует страницу или производит покупку, платформа моментально записывает обновлённые данные. up x зеркало подтверждает современность данных для каждого участников совместно.
Синхронизация данных между несколькими серверами гарантирует согласованность распределённых платформ. Изменения, произведённые на одном хосте, автономно копируются на иные узлы. ап икс предотвращает противоречия в информации и предоставляет единообразие информации.
Коллизии при совместном корректировке идентичных и тех же данных улаживаются специальными алгоритмами. База данных блокирует данные на срок модификации или эксплуатирует оптимистичную подход регулирования. Комплекс наблюдает редакции информации и блокирует потерю модификаций.
Копирование информации создаёт копии базы на географически размещённых серверах. Пользователи имеют доступ к близлежащему машине, что снижает лаги. Усиливает стабильность структуры при сбоях оборудования.
Дублирующее копирование и регенерация сведений
Архивное дублирование оберегает базы данных от потери исключительно ценной сведений. Системы автоматически генерируют копии данных через назначенные интервалы времени. Архивные экземпляры хранятся на отдельных устройствах или внешних хостах.
Полное дублирование производит слепок полной базы данных в определённый момент времени. Такие экземпляры позволяют реконструировать комплекс полностью. Осуществляет полное архивирование понедельно или помесячно в отношении от количества информации.
Добавочное копирование фиксирует только корректировки, произошедшие с момента последней архивной реплики. Такой метод сберегает место на дисках и оптимизирует процедуру. Объединяет полное и частичное сохранение для идеального баланса.
Возврат данных приводит базу в операционное форму после отказов или неточностей. Специалисты назначают требуемую дублирующую копию и стартуют процесс возврата. ап икс официальный сайт сокращает период неработоспособности и исчезновение данных при аварийных случаях.
Значение баз данных в деятельности нынешних программ и ресурсов
Базы данных образуют базис любого нынешнего веб-приложения или мобильного приложения. Без комплексов контроля данными нереализуема функционирование онлайн-платформ, которыми пользуются миллиарды людей каждодневно. Каждый касание или действие пользователя соприкасается с базой данных.
Адаптивный материал ресурсов создаётся на основе данных из баз данных. Новостные порталы получают статьи, форумы подгружают сообщения, а видеохостинги получают метаданные записей. Это даёт возможность производить персонализированный содержимое для каждого посетителя.
Портативные программы выравнивают данные с онлайн базами для предоставления подключения с различных аппаратов. Участник стартует процесс на смартфоне и продолжает на планшете без исчезновения результата. ап икс осуществляет непрерывный опыт использования на наборе сред.
Статистические платформы выполняют данные из баз для принятия коммерческих решений. Предприятия исследуют манеру пользователей и предвидят запрос. ап икс официальный сайт преобразует необработанные сведения в значимые выводы для совершенствования товаров.
